Replacing windows involves a few variables that influence the total project cost. The biggest factor is the material you select,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, as well as the style of window, like double-hung versus casement. The condition of your existing frames matters, too; if there is hidden rot or water damage, that requires extra labor to fix. Choosing triple-pane glass for better insulation or adding decorative grids will also shift the final number. Your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.

Correct window installation involves ensuring the frame is perfectly plumb and level, securely fastened, and then meticulously sealed to prevent air and water leaks. This is critical for optimal energy efficiency and preventing structural damage. The pros understand these vital steps for a lasting installation.

You should consider replacement if you notice drafts, condensation between glass panes, or difficulty operating your windows. High energy bills, especially during extreme weather, and visible damage are also strong indicators. Upgrading can significantly enhance your home's comfort and efficiency.
